Misconceptions Concerning LASIK Pain
As opposed to popular belief, LASIK surgery isn't as excruciating as lots of people believe. The procedure itself is reasonably quick and pain-free. You might really feel some stress or pain throughout the surgery, yet it's typically very little. The cosmetic surgeon will utilize numbing eye drops to make certain that you do not really feel any pain throughout the process.
While it's normal to experience some dry skin, itching, or light pain in the hours adhering to the surgery, this can usually be taken care of with over the counter pain medicine and eye declines. It's important to follow your doctor's post-operative care guidelines to lessen any pain and promote proper recovery.
Keep in mind that every person's discomfort tolerance is different, so what someone may call uneasy may be completely tolerable for an additional. Rest assured that LASIK pain is normally not a major issue and shouldn't discourage you from considering this life-changing treatment.

Eligibility Misconceptions
Some people erroneously believe that just people with serious vision troubles are qualified for LASIK surgery. Nonetheless, this is an usual misunderstanding. While LASIK is commonly associated with treating high degrees of nearsightedness, farsightedness, and astigmatism, individuals with milder vision issues can likewise be eligible candidates. In fact, improvements in LASIK technology have actually increased the variety of treatable prescriptions, enabling even more individuals to gain from the procedure.
LASIK qualification is identified via a detailed eye examination by a qualified eye doctor. Factors such as corneal density, eye health and wellness, and overall case history play a vital role in examining a person's viability for the surgical procedure.
Even people over 40, who may have presbyopia (age-related problem concentrating on close objects), can possibly go through LASIK or other vision Correction treatments.
It is very important not to self-diagnose your qualification for LASIK surgical treatment. Consulting with an experienced eye care specialist is the most effective method to establish if you're an ideal prospect for this life-changing procedure.
